Attribution
For a credit line: Wisconsin Historical Society, Creator, Title, Unique Identifier.
The Unique Identifier can be found at the top or bottom of the page for each item. The name of a downloaded file is NOT the unique identifier.
For bibliographic citations please consult the UW-Madison Libraries Citation Research Guide to ensure compliance with appropriate style guidelines.
